MOST GREAT LOVERS IF THEY LIVED TODAY WOULD BE CONSIDERED JUVENILE DELINQUENTS. AND SO IT IS WITH BROWNIE AND LOLA, TWO DISPLACED TEENAGERS WHO FIND THEIR HOMES IN EACH OTHER. BUT IN BRISBANE IN THE FIFTIES, THE AGE OF PONY TAILS, ROCK N ROLL AND BACKSTREET ABORTIONS, THOSE WHO GO THEIR OWN WAY ARE NOT REBELS BUT DELINQUENTS. IN THE EYES OF THE WORLD - THAT IS, OF THEIR MOTHERS, WELFARE AND THE COPS - THEY ARE UNPREPARED FOR ADULT RESPONSIBILITIES. Criena Rohan's breakout novel of young love in the rockin' '50s, now reissued as a Text Classic. Brownie and Lola are in love - with each other, and with the exciting world of '50s Brisbane with its rock'n'roll, new fashions and fabulous hairdos.In the eyes of the adult world (and of the law) these two lovebirds are simply juvenile delinquents, and they will stop at nothing to drive Brownie and Lola apart. Can their love survive?
